Cranberry Cornbread
Cranberry Cornbread pairs a tender, moist crumb with bursts of sweet-tart berries for a lively contrast in every bite. Subtle corn sweetness balances the bright cranberries, making it a festive side for Thanksgiving or any winter gathering. Serve warm alongside roasted meats or with a swipe of butter for a cozy, seasonal touch.

- 1
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C). Grease an 8-inch square baking dish.
- 2
Toss cranberries with 1 tablespoon sugar in a bowl; set aside. In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, cornmeal, 1/2 cup s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
- 3
In a third bowl, whisk milk, eggs, and melted butter; stir into the flour mixture just until the batter is moistened. Stir the cranberries into the batter; pour into the prepared baking dish.
- 4
Bake in the preheated oven for 18 to 20 minutes, until the cornbread is golden brown. Cool completely in the pan before cutting into squares.
